Aptitude and Reasoning Questions

Q:

If 6th March, 2005 is Monday, what was the day of the week on 6th March, 2004?

A) Sunday B) Saturday
C) Tuesday D) Wednesday
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: A) Sunday

Explanation:

The year 2004 is a leap year. So, it has 2 odd days.

But, Feb 2004 not included because we are calculating from March 2004 to March 2005.

So it has 1 odd day only.

The day on 6th March, 2005 will be 1 day beyond the day on 6th March, 2004.

Given that, 6th March, 2005 is Monday.

6th March, 2004 is Sunday (1 day before to 6th March, 2005).
